Emerging Technologies in Data Center Cooling

A range of technologies are in development that aim to revolutionize how data centers manage heat:

  • Liquid Cooling Systems: Utilizing specialized fluids to transfer heat away from servers efficiently, reducing reliance on traditional air conditioning.
  • Evaporative Cooling: This technology leverages the natural cooling properties of water vapor, significantly decreasing energy consumption.
  • Recycled Water Systems: In regions where water is plentiful, systems that use recycled water can minimize the environmental impact.
  • Phase Change Materials (PCMs): These materials absorb and release thermal energy, offering another layer of passive cooling to reduce peak temperatures.
